Join our growing team as an E-Commerce & Marketing Assistant! This is a fantastic opportunity for a recent graduate eager to get hands-on experience in the world of e-commerce and digital marketing. You will be helping us grow our online presence, improve product content, and engage with our customers in meaningful ways. If you're data-driven, adaptable, and ready to take on new challenges, we'd love to hear from you!

What We're Looking For:

  • Collaborating with our e-commerce team to support and enhance current projects.
  • Launching and managing exciting product recycling schemes across various digital platforms.
  • Regularly reviewing product content, pricing, images, and categories to ensure a smooth and engaging customer experience.
  • Analyzing sales, pricing, and stock levels, and implementing strategies to drive sales and improve inventory management.
  • Exploring new ways to boost the performance of our online stores and enhance customer satisfaction.

Who You Are:

  • A relevant qualification in e-commerce or digital marketing.
  • A sharp, methodical mind with a natural ability to extract meaningful insights from data.
  • A proactive, self-motivated attitude with a keen interest in learning new systems.
  • Excellent communication skills (both written and verbal) with a professional approach.
  • A strong business sense and an ability to work independently while meeting deadlines.

What's in It for You:

  • A competitive salary with the chance to progress in a fast-growing, forward-thinking company.
  • A supportive, collaborative work environment where your ideas and efforts make a real impact.
  • A permanent, full-time role based in our friendly offices near Boston, Lincolnshire.
